Interview: Marlis Ladurée, painter of contemporary mandalas
"Painting is for me the opportunity to free impressions, to receive and transmit messages." A conversation with the artist about her practice, her vision of the contemporary mandala, and the glazing technique inherited from Renaissance masters.
- ✦Discovery of mandalas during a presentation by Brigitte Neveux at the Hatha Yoga Federation, 1989
- ✦The contemporary approach influenced by Carl Jung and his concept of the 'European Mandala'
- ✦Glazing technique: 20 layers of translucent oil paint superimposed, sometimes over several months
- ✦A meditative state as a condition for creation — the studio as a 'small celestial palace'
- ✦Collectors from around the world, from the spiritual to pure aesthetics
